This summer, the Summons Lab welcomed two visiting students, Nan Sun and Yongli Li, from the University of Science and Technology of China.

After weeks of labwork and analyses, the two presented their summer work to the lab group. Nan worked closely with Gareth Izon, and presented her research titled “Questioning the Paradigm of Earth’s Oxygenation.” Yongli worked with Thomas Evans, and presented “Realizing the Full Potential of Intact Polar Lipid Membrane Proxies.” Both student projects yielded fascinating insights!

Following the presentations, all headed to group dinner at MuLan — a Summons Lab tradition — to celebrate a successful summer, Nan and Yongli’s presentations, as well as group member birthdays. A convenient rotating dinner table allowed the group to be captured via video!
